Ingrown toenail

Ingrown toenail is a condition where the toenail grows into the flesh, causing inflammation and pain. While it can occur on any toenail, it is more commonly seen on the big toe.


The main causes are often attributed to improper toenail trimming and wearing high-heeled or narrow shoes for extended periods. Additionally, conditions where footwear lacks proper ventilation, such as safety or work boots, can contribute to the development of ingrown toenails.


Especially in cases where individuals have conditions like diabetes, complications such as secondary infections due to ingrown toenails can occur. Therefore, it is advisable to seek diagnosis and treatment at a foot clinic to address ingrown toenails and potential complications.
